Tokyo Solamachi is a massive shopping and entertainment complex located at the base of the world’s tallest tower, Tokyo Skytree. Directly connected to Tokyo Skytree Station on the Tobu Skytree Line and Oshiage (Skytree-mae) Station on the Tokyo Metro, it’s the perfect base for sightseeing in Tokyo. It’s about 25 minutes from Tokyo Station and about 3 minutes from Asakusa. There are over 300 diverse shops and restaurants offering a wide variety of fashion, miscellaneous goods, and gourmet food, showcasing both modern and traditional Japan. A food court. Approximately 11 restaurants offering a variety of cuisines, including Japanese, Western, Chinese, and ethnic. Popular restaurants include Hakata Ippudo (ramen), Tsukiji Kaisen Tojo (seafood bowls), Miyatake Sanuki Udon, JASMINE THAI Express (Thai cuisine), and Ebisu Yakiniku Champion.
